One of the leading providers of fleet management software for larger fleets is now turning its attention to those businesses running smaller fleets.
The company, called Jaama, is offering a free three-month trial of its FleetAssistant software which has been specially designed for businesses running smaller fleets.
Jaama says FleetAssistant is the most advanced web-based fleet system on the market. It is targeted at improving the fleet management, reducing the operating costs and managing the duty of care for companies operating smaller fleets of cars, vans and commercial vehicles as well as managing employees who drive their own cars on business.
The web-based system costs £250 for a system set-up fee and then monthly management charges start at 33p per vehicle. The offer is for a free three-month trial to try it out.
FleetAssistant incorporates Jaama’s RiskAssistant, which aids occupational road risk legislative compliance and seamlessly integrates with Jaama’s online driver licence validity checking with the DVLA database.
The system also comes with full help desk support and future software updates to reflect improvements in technology and updates in the industry.
